Course Content

• Integrating Technology in Mathematics Teaching
• Technology-Based Assessment Strategies in Math
• Utilizing Dynamic Geometry Software (e.g., GeoGebra)
• Data Analysis and Visualization with Technology (Spreadsheets, Statistical Software)
• Developing Interactive Math Lessons using Multimedia
• Algorithmic Thinking and Programming for Math Instruction
• Creating Engaging Math Games and Simulations
• Addressing Accessibility Needs with Assistive Technology in Math Class
